During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Universidad Adventista de las Antillas paid an average of $185 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$6,050 | $6,050 |
Fees | $1,200 | $1,200 |
Books and Supplies | $1,600 | $1,600 |
On Campus Room and Board | $6,200 | $6,200 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$3,000 | $3,000 |

All of the students who received their Bachelor’s in health professions in 2019-2020 were women.
Of those students who received a bachelor’s degree in health professions at Universidad Adventista de las Antillas in 2019-2020, all were racial-ethnic minorities*.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 6 |
Native American or Alaska Native | 0 |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 0 |
White | 0 |
International Students | 0 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 0 |
